Transponder Chips Transponder chips are found in the top part of modern smart keys, fobs and remotes. They permit your car to start whenever you use them. This chip transmits a code to the engine immobilizer in the car and allows it to know that it&#39;s a legitimate key. The chip transmits this ID code by radio to the computer in the car. If the ID code matches the one in the memory of the vehicle the security system of the car will turn off the immobilizer and allow the engine begin. The security light on the dashboard will go out once this has happened. Keyless Entry Keyless entry is a feature that allows you to open and start your car without needing to insert a physical key. It utilizes wireless signals to connect with the car&#39;s internal system and it also lets you to control different functions in the vehicle including climate controls or music systems. Modern keyless entry systems use rolling code technology to guard against security breaches. However it is important to keep in mind that even this technology has its limitations. A thief could use a technique known as “replay attack” to transmit a message that is recorded by the receiver of the car. After the message has been recorded, a malicious device could retransmit the message to the car&#39;s receiver in order to gain access.
